If you want to get into inter quickly, your best option will be to do more c&p and less brush. However if you want to improve your skills more you should practice brushing, because it'll pay off eventually and you'll be inter when your skills are good enough.

On the chop: it's alright. Brushing's pretty basic and blocky looking - not really smooth. There's something wrong with the lighting too. The way it is it looks like there's a light source coming from directly behind the car, but the sun doesn't seem to be there. Keep working hard though, eventually you'll get to inter ;)

its def. not horrible but you have a lot of practice ahead on brushing.

my best advice would be dont brush in black or white , learn brushing in real colors (reds-greens-yellows) this will allow you to also try shading and highliting (thats what basicly makes a brush job look realistic or not)

trust me b/w are hard to brush , very hard :-d
